Mailinglisten-Archive |
"Wolfgang M. Weyand" schrieb: > > Hi all, > > ich habe ein Problem beim Zugrif auf einen Oracle Server 7.3.2.2.0. > TNSNAMES.ORA ist korrekt eingerichtet, ein tnsping sid auf den Server > funktioniert, ora_logon unter PHP bringt jedoch immer den Fehler ORA-12154 - > could not resolve service name. Auf Grund von Hinweisen in der > de.comp.lang.php FAQ habe ich die Environment-Variablen ORACLE_HOME und > ORACLE_SID sowohl im PHP-Script als auch alternativ in der httpd.conf des > Apache Servers gesetzt. Nach einem Hinweis in einer Usenetgruppe habe ich > auch versuchsweise die Variable TNS_ADMIN auf den Pfad zu TNSNAMES.ORA > gesetzt. Alles leider ohne Erfolg. > Arbeitsumgebung : > > PHP 4.04 als CGI auf Apache 1.3.12 unter Windows NT 4 > Oracle 7.3.2.2.0 Server unter Windows NT 4 Hi, wenn Du die PHP4 von www.php4win.de benutzt sieht das nicht rosig aus, da diese Version ein Oracle 8.1.6 voraussetzt. Entweder Du versuchst es mit ODBC oder, wenn Oracle auf nem anderen Rechner läuft wie Apache, installierst Du einfach den Client von Oracle 8.1.6 auf dem Apache Rechner und stellst dann eine Verbindung her. Gruss Ron
php::bar PHP Wiki - Listenarchive